I used Dr. Almanza for my surgery in May of 2011. I am very satisfied with the whole experience. It is a clinic, not a hospital. It was very clean and we were well taken care of. You go to a staffed recovery house, not a hotel for recovery. I felt the care was excellent there as well. There are a lot of great surgeons in Mexico as well as here in the states. I do think price is part of the equation but not he deciding factor. You just have to do your research and choose a surgeon you feel comfortable with. I will tell you this, you are NOT receiving sub-par care just because you pay less with Dr. Almanza, as you can tell by the posts, he has many very happy and successful patients on the forums. The main factor for me was the communication with the Doctor and the coordinator, they were there to answer many questions before the surgery and even now. Who is your coordinator?

Hi I am currently here in TJ and I just got sleeved by Dr. Kelly on Monday. I was in the hospital for three days with round the hour care. It is not a clinic and there is an icu and radiology as well as anything necessary. I am 28 and I wanted someone who was great and priced correct. I can only speak on my experience and I have posted about my journey so far. I came in on sunday and i was admitted into the hospital. I just checked into the hotel and i am here until friday morning. Dr. Kelly just came here to check on me and speak with me. I am happy so far with my decision.

Hi,

Bingo you said the magic word "Homework or as I called it educated myself." The price was much higher in the US, but the care lacked a lot--in the good old US they send you home the day after the surgery. And guess what Dr. Aceves has trained a lot of US doctors how to do this procedure. I wanted the doctor with the most experience and someone who actually cared about me after the surgery. That is just what I got. Yes, I looked at a lot of doctors, but I wanted the very best for ME this is about ME and no one else. And for me my choice is and was Dr. Aceves.

I feel very lucky that I could afford to have it done here in the US, but that was not my choice. Their infections rates are higher here in the US also. I compared the US Hospitals infection rates to Dr. Aceves and his if by far less than any US hospital. So yes, Dr. Aceves was my choice after 6 months of spending hours each day on the computer checking things out; and talking to people who had gone to other doctors and who had gone to Dr. Aceves. It wasn't an overnight choice. I also had a good friend who is a Nurse Practitioner who went to Dr. Aceves and I respected her judgment. But, she made me do my own research and investigating into what was going to be best for me.

It is great that we have all these choices and we can make choice based on what is best for us. I can only talk about what was best for me and what I wanted and what I expected when it came to surgery and care after the WLS. When I was in a hospital in the US, I NEVER saw 2 doctors 3 times a day! That is unheard of. I have no idea what the doctors are like that charge less, I can only tell you what kind of care I got. Thanks for you ccomments and take care....... Suzanne
